Output ef01c03761db52fc0953d437d03bc1868719a66b4935a783bfad0628959b7501:1

value
344050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ecb866622d5daedd7029dbadcb19cf432ff262f OP_EQUALVERIFY OP_CHECKSIG
address
DJA8JfQZ4kXzf7HJAEGhwykh3TLFR5vZvw
transaction
ef01c03761db52fc0953d437d03bc1868719a66b4935a783bfad0628959b7501